hEngelia: MSN audio is similar to SIP. There is a service called gtalk2voip that redirects MSN calls to VOIP accounts. I wonder if there is any scope for doing that that in a client. i.e client advertises it is available for chat, and when it receives a request forwards it to a SIP account. And if the chat button is pressed it initiates a call to the sip account and when answered it connects it to the MSN account.
